    I bought that same wig!! LOL. I couldn't use it for dancing because it was too long and thick... It would have fallen off or gotten snagged on something during lapdances. The scalp area also wasn't very convincing on me, but my head is a bit small for wigs. They never look right.

    I did use it a few times for camming, though, and it seemed to pass as real hair.

    Since you mentioned hair extensions, I'm surprised they didn't work for you. My hair is freakishly thin... I'm basically balding, lol... And I wear them every day with no issue. You mentioned that they were hard on your scalp... You may have been clipping them in incorrectly, or using a bad brand. They shouldn't hurt, and you shouldn't even be able to feel them. I suppose if you have a particularly sensitive scalp, then it could be a problem.
